I have longed for a simple checklist app for things I do repeatedly. I have embarrassed myself many times by forgetting to put a link in a newsletter, by posts getting published incorrectly, by forgetting the dumbest things that I know I'm smart enough to do... if only I remembered to do them. That's what makes this app so dreamy and perfect. For one, any process I do can now be a checklist. I'll never forget to do every part of the process. Second, the checklist resets every time I finish it, which is perfect. I often have to do the same process twice. Third, no data is collected. This makes it worth it, straight away. Fourth, indie developer. It feels good giving my money to someone who sweated at creating such a useful all by himself. If there were any critiques, it'd be that I'd like to see my lists backed up, just in case my phone dies. But, really, that's okay. Not sure what that's do for the data policy anyways. Overall, get the app if you're a workflow type of person. It helps to systemize processes so they can get done the same way, each time.
